Output 418539044e25fe75c9259e20be45d4e14ad33ef27c408fa31c995b57966972c8:0

value
18970860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7dfa8410b7feb69674d47df8487197a1611b1f4 OP_EQUAL
address
3Nq3wqLap9qyujtqmU8EboYtExp1Ud52kZ
transaction
418539044e25fe75c9259e20be45d4e14ad33ef27c408fa31c995b57966972c8
confirmations
440034
spent
true